Overview
The project investigates the impact of connectivity on the presence and activity of physical markets and, consequently, economic activity in remote areas of low- and middle-income countries, using satellite imagery. While previous research has explored the effects of connectivity on online trade, measuring the effects on offline economic activity, especially in rural developing areas, has been challenging. Policymakers, governments, and other stakeholders involved in connectivity can leverage the insights from this research project to improve strategies for prioritizing connectivity expansion in rural regions of developing countries.
Background
Previous research has found significant relationships between internet connectivity and productivity, sales, and employment in developing countries. Prior findings on how internet connectivity may facilitate access to new markets and increase online sales and e-commerce have provided invaluable insights into the relationship between connectivity and e-commerce. However, there is a lack of evidence on the effect of internet connectivity on the presence and activity of physical markets in rural communities.
Research Questions
How do internet connectivity and accessibility affect the presence and activity of physical marketplaces, and consequently economic activity, in rural communities in developing countries?
Preliminary insights
-
Building density is a significant predictor of school internet connectivity in Rwanda, yet infrastructure availability alone is not sufficient to ensure school connectivity.
-
School connectivity depends on surrounding built-environment conditions rather than schools’ internal attributes alone.
-
Investments in school connectivity infrastructure may yield benefits for local market development, warranting longitudinal analyses to further clarify the socioeconomic outcomes of connectivity.
Key statistics
-
The transition from low to high mobile internet penetration in Rwanda increased employment by 11 percentage points.
-
Despite being within the coverage range of 3G or 4G towers, 15.8% of schools in Rwanda remain unconnected.
